//! These examples only really exist so we can use them for flamegraph. If they get annoying to
//! maintain, feel free to delete.
use types::{
test_utils::generate_deterministic_keypair, BeaconState, Eth1Data, EthSpec, Hash256,
MinimalEthSpec, Validator,
};
type E = MinimalEthSpec;
fn get_state(validator_count: usize) -> BeaconState<E> {
let spec = &E::default_spec();
let eth1_data = Eth1Data {
deposit_root: Hash256::zero(),
deposit_count: 0,
block_hash: Hash256::zero(),
};
let mut state = BeaconState::new(0, eth1_data, spec);
for i in 0..validator_count {
state.balances.push(i as u64).expect("should add balance");
state
.validators
.push(Validator {
pubkey: generate_deterministic_keypair(i).pk.into(),
withdrawal_credentials: Hash256::from_low_u64_le(i as u64),
effective_balance: i as u64,
slashed: i % 2 == 0,
activation_eligibility_epoch: i.into(),
activation_epoch: i.into(),
exit_epoch: i.into(),
withdrawable_epoch: i.into(),
})
.expect("should add validator");
}
state
}
fn main() {
let validator_count = 1_024;
let state = get_state(validator_count);
for _ in 0..100_000 {
let _ = state.clone();
}
}
